Langtang Trek, located in the Langtang region of Nepal, is a moderate Himalayan trek offering stunning views of snow-capped peaks, alpine forests, and remote Tamang villages. Known for its natural beauty and cultural richness, the trek passes through Langtang National Park, home to diverse flora and fauna, including red pandas, Himalayan monkeys, and colorful birds. Langtang Trek is ideal for adventure seekers, nature lovers, and photographers who want a less-crowded alternative to Everest and Annapurna treks.

Trip Overview
Region: Langtang, Nepal
Duration: 7–10 Days (customizable)
Difficulty Level: Moderate
Best Seasons: March–May, September–November
Start / End Point: Syabrubesi / Kathmandu

Sample Itinerary
Day 01: Drive from Kathmandu to Syabrubesi, overnight stay
Day 02: Trek from Syabrubesi to Lama Hotel
Day 03: Trek to Langtang Village, explore local culture
Day 04: Trek to Kyanjin Gompa, visit monastery and enjoy Himalayan views
Day 05: Explore Kyanjin Gompa surroundings, optional hikes to Tserko Ri
Day 06: Trek back to Lama Hotel
Day 07: Trek to Syabrubesi, drive back to Kathmandu
